The Cleveland Plain Dealer reports, "State lawmakers Nickie J. Antonio, Dan Ramos, propose an end to capital punishment in Ohio." It's by Robert Higgs.
The state’s latest scheduled execution was put on hold after an inmate asked to donate his organs with his death. Now two lawmakers from Northeast Ohio say the practice should be ended altogether.
Democratic Reps. Nickie J. Antonio of Lakewood and Dan Ramos will highlight their proposal Tuesday in an appearance with Kevin Werner, the executive director of Ohioans to Stop Executions.
The proposal faces an uphill climb.
Antonio and Ramos are two of 39 Democrats in the 99-member Ohio House of Representatives. Getting the law changed would require support of Republicans there, as well as in the Republican-dominated Ohio Senate.
